rs-data-grid-vue

A configurable data grid component for Vue — filtering, sorting, pagination, inline/popup/batch editing, drag-and-drop rows/columns, and Excel/PDF export.

Install

npm install rs-data-grid-vue

vue (^3.5.40) and vuetify (^4.1.7) are peer dependencies — install them in your app if you haven't already. Vuetify must be registered as an app-level plugin; the grid renders its dialogs/inputs through your app's own Vuetify instance rather than bundling one of its own.

Usage

<script setup lang="ts">
import { RsDataGrid } from 'rs-data-grid-vue';
</script>

<template>
  <RsDataGrid
    theme="light"
    fetch-url="https://api.example.com/items"
    :pagination="true"
    :show-filter="true"
    :show-sort="true"
    :show-search="true"
    grid-mode="popup"
  />
</template>

No separate CSS import is needed — styles are bundled with the component.

Data

Provide data either by URL (fetch-url, fetched with fetch-method/fetch-headers/auth-token) or directly via data-source. Columns are inferred from the data's own keys unless you pass an explicit columns array ({ dataField, caption }[]).

Key props

| Prop | Type | Default | Description | | --- | --- | --- | --- | | theme | 'light' \| 'dark' | 'light' | Color theme | | fetch-url / data-source | string / any[] | — | Where the grid gets its rows | | columns | IColumn[] | inferred | Explicit column list | | grid-mode | 'popup' \| 'row' \| 'batch' | 'popup' | Add/edit interaction style | | pagination | boolean | false | Enable paging | | show-filter / show-sort / show-search | boolean | false | Toolbar/header features | | drag-drop-rows / drag-drop-columns | boolean | false | Enable drag-to-reorder | | export-excel / exportPDF | boolean | false | Toolbar export buttons — bind exportPDF in camelCase, not kebab-case | | @row-add / @row-edit / @row-delete / @batch-save | (row) => void | — | CRUD events |

See RsDataGridProps in the shipped type declarations for the full list.
